Abstract

The economy of distribution networks largely depends on the utilization rate of distribution network equipment. Most of the emerging intelligent power consumption technologies have a positive effect on equipment utilization and their use can save investment of distribution networks. In this paper, the influence of intelligent power consumption technologies on the utilization rate of distribution network equipment is reviewed. The evaluation methods and indexes are assessed first and then intelligent power consumption equipment with energy storage function, vehicle-to-grid (V2G) technology and time-of-use (TOU) tariff are reviewed respectively. It is concluded that these intelligent power consumption technologies and measures have great potential to improve utilization rate of distribution network equipment because of their effective improvement to power load. Meanwhile, recommendations on how to utilize these intelligent power consumption technologies to improve utilization rate of distribution network equipment are proposed.

DSM and demand response (DR) as the two most important methods in intelligent power consumption [34], are applied to encourage consumers to participate in shifting peak load, and have a great effect on the improvement of the utilization rate of distribution network equipment. Combining the DSM with the intelligent power equipment with energy storage function in a right way can shift the load from the peak to the valley period of distribution networks, improve the load rate and decrease the capacity of the distribution transformers.
